Transportation and Meeting
The tour includes private transportation from select locations in Atlanta to Senoia, Georgia.
Guests can be picked up from Midtown, Downtown, or Buckhead areas, with the meeting point being at 423 John Wesley Dobbs Ave NE, Atlanta, GA 30312.
The tour ends back at the same meeting location upon return from Senoia.

Tour Audience and Restrictions
Although the tour isn’t wheelchair accessible, it caters to a wide range of age groups, with participants as young as 13 welcome to join the experience.
The tour is suitable for teenagers and adults alike, but children between 13 and 17 must be accompanied by a paying adult. This ensures a safe and enjoyable environment for all guests.
